Job description

We are seeking a seasoned Senior Database Administrator (DBA) - III to provide high-level technical support, architecture design, and problem management for critical, complex enterprise databases. In this role, you will be responsible for the end-to-end lifecycle of our data infrastructure-including complex installations, customizations, proactive tuning, and strict security administration. You will collaborate on strategic infrastructure planning, formulate requirements for new database systems, and leverage automation to optimize system delivery. The ideal candidate is an expert in Oracle high-availability environments who applies a disciplined risk-management approach to system changes., Database Infrastructure & High Availability Installation & Configuration: Lead complex installation, configuration, patching, and customization of the Oracle Relational Database Management System (RDBMS). Cluster Management: Administer and troubleshoot Oracle Clusterware (CRS) concepts, configurations, and complex multi-node environments. Disaster Recovery: Configure and maintain Data Guard environments; execute seamless switchovers and failovers to ensure maximum uptime and zero data loss. Strategic Architecture: Assist in long-term strategic planning, database design, and structure optimization; provide expert recommendations on functional and business requirements.

Operations, Performance & Security Performance Tuning: Perform advanced problem analysis for complex configurations, executing proactive database monitoring and deep-dive tuning to optimize critical workloads. Backup & Recovery: Own the backup and recovery mechanisms using RMAN, ensuring strict adherence to enterprise data protection policies. Security & Patching: Support Patch Set Update/Release Update (PSU/RU) patching; implement robust database security controls and manage access permissions. System Automation: Script and automate core Oracle functions using shell scripting and Ansible playbook deployment.

Project Delivery & Governance System Migration: Analyze existing database structures, formulate transition/implementation plans, and guide users through the adoption of upgraded systems. Risk Management: Apply a disciplined risk-management framework to all database decisions and system modifications to minimize organizational vulnerability. Collaborative Support: Partner with infrastructure teams (Linux/AIX, Unix, Storage, and Windows) to align database performance with hardware and network capacity.
